GIMLET CAFE + BAR

Located within another one of our projects, Warders cottages, Gimlet is a small Aperitivo cafe a side offering to the hotel and connection through to reception.

The Gimlet is named after the citrus and gin based cocktail that is recorded as having been very popular with English naval officers in in the 1800s as a suitable ration to ward off scurvy.
